Location: 16 oz can from Winooski Beverage, 8/23/15

Aroma: The nose of this beer is roasted malts, heavy malty in general, nutty, light toast
Appearance: This over pours a brown color with light brown/tan head and medium-plus lacing
Flavor: Taste-wise, this is nutty and malty, a little sweet, roasty as well, lightly bitter
Palate: It drinks fairly lightly, not watery, with a soft carbonation, and a smooth, clean closure
Overall Impression: I found this to be really drinkable and clean. It works nicely. The flavor and aroma aren't strong enough for me to go higher than this from a score perspective, but it's a minimally flawed beer with a nice mouthfeel.

Bottom of the can stamped 06/09/15.
This was poured into a mug.
The appearance was a nice looking hazy dark brown color with a one finger white foamy head that dissipated within about a minute leaving some light messy lacing sticking around the glass.
The smell started off with a nutty spiciness allowing allowing fair cocoa and coffee to balance.
The taste was sweet nutty and cocoa. Letting the coffee become the bitter part. Lingering sweet to nutty character runs in the aftertaste. There’s no finish.
On the palate, this one sat about a light to medium on the body with a fairly decent sessionability about it. Carbonation seemed good for the style and for me. Bitterness is there but not overbearing.
Overall, as an American Brown Ale it works. I’d have again.
